From 081b4e53881e302408f34c0a760f679fd5add027 Mon Sep 17 00:00:00 2001 From: Sam S Date: Fri, 9 Nov 2018 11:47:06 -0800 Subject: [PATCH 1/2] Modernize deps --- app/build.gradle | 10 +++++----- build.gradle | 2 +- gradle/wrapper/gradle-wrapper.properties | 4 ++-- media-picker/build.gradle | 16 ++++++++-------- 4 files changed, 16 insertions(+), 16 deletions(-) diff --git a/app/build.gradle b/app/build.gradle index 606dd46..9e47783 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-3,13 +3,13 @@ apply plugin: 'com.android.application' //noinspection GroovyMissingReturnStatement android { - compileSdkVersion 25 - buildToolsVersion '26.0.2' + compileSdkVersion 27 + buildToolsVersion '28.0.3' defaultConfig { applicationId "com.miguelgaeta.android_media_picker" minSdkVersion 16 - targetSdkVersion 25 + targetSdkVersion 27 versionCode 1 versionName "1.0" } @@ -33,13 +33,13 @@ android { dependencies { // Support libraries. - compile 'com.android.support:appcompat-v7:25.4.0' + compile 'com.android.support:appcompat-v7:27+' // Rx Java permissions handler. compile 'com.tbruyelle.rxpermissions:rxpermissions:0.5.2@aar' // Rx Java - compile 'io.reactivex:rxjava:1.3.2' + compile 'io.reactivex:rxjava:1.3.4' // Rx Java bindings. compile 'com.jakewharton.rxbinding:rxbinding:0.2.0' diff --git a/build.gradle b/build.gradle index b69d5bc..0c2a798 100644 --- a/build.gradle +++ b/build.gradle @@ -7,7 +7,7 @@ buildscript { } dependencies { - classpath 'com.android.tools.build:gradle:3.0.0' + classpath 'com.android.tools.build:gradle:3.2.1' } } diff --git a/gradle/wrapper/gradle-wrapper.properties b/gradle/wrapper/gradle-wrapper.properties index 6312c27..ba38a36 100644 --- a/gradle/wrapper/gradle-wrapper.properties +++ b/gradle/wrapper/gradle-wrapper.properties @@ -1,6 +1,6 @@ -#Tue Nov 07 22:04:14 PST 2017 +#Fri Nov 09 11:28:44 PST 2018 dist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ists zipStoreBase=GRADLE_USER_HOME zipStorePath=wrapper/dists -distributionUrl=https\://services.gradle.org/distributions/gradle-4.1-all.zip +distributionUrl=https\://services.gradle.org/distributions/gradle-4.6-all.zip diff --git a/media-picker/build.gradle b/media-picker/build.gradle index 982ca2e..61d9dad 100644 --- a/media-picker/build.gradle +++ b/media-picker/build.gradle @@ -2,12 +2,12 @@ apply plugin: 'com.android.library' //noinspection GroovyMissingReturnStatement android { - compileSdkVersion 25 - buildToolsVersion '26.0.2' + compileSdkVersion 27 + buildToolsVersion '28.0.3' defaultConfig { minSdkVersion 15 - targetSdkVersion 25 + targetSdkVersion 27 versionCode 1 versionName "1.0" } @@ -23,19 +23,19 @@ android { dependencies { //noinspection GradleDynamicVersion - provided 'com.android.support:appcompat-v7:25+' + provided 'com.android.support:appcompat-v7:27+' //noinspection GradleDynamicVersion - provided 'com.android.support:animated-vector-drawable:25+' + provided 'com.android.support:animated-vector-drawable:27+' //noinspection GradleDynamicVersion - provided 'com.android.support:support-compat:25+' + provided 'com.android.support:support-compat:27+' //noinspection GradleDynamicVersion - provided 'com.android.support:support-core-utils:25+' + provided 'com.android.support:support-core-utils:27+' // File cropping utility. - compile 'com.github.yalantis:ucrop:2.2.1' + compile 'com.github.yalantis:ucrop:2.2.2' } apply from: '../build.release-aar.gradle' From 65a0752a2f682ddfc5c1b04fad4a8dffcdf78ceb Mon Sep 17 00:00:00 2001 From: Sam S Date: Fri, 9 Nov 2018 11:57:18 -0800 Subject: [PATCH 2/2] update gradle dep configuration --- app/build.gradle | 10 +++++----- media-picker/build.gradle | 10 +++++----- 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/app/build.gradle b/app/build.gradle index 9e47783..71cb120 100644 --- a/app/build.gradle +++ b/app/build.gradle @@ -33,16 +33,16 @@ android { dependencies { // Support libraries. - compile 'com.android.support:appcompat-v7:27+' + implementation 'com.android.support:appcompat-v7:27+' // Rx Java permissions handler. - compile 'com.tbruyelle.rxpermissions:rxpermissions:0.5.2@aar' + implementation 'com.tbruyelle.rxpermissions:rxpermissions:0.5.2@aar' // Rx Java - compile 'io.reactivex:rxjava:1.3.4' + implementation 'io.reactivex:rxjava:1.3.4' // Rx Java bindings. - compile 'com.jakewharton.rxbinding:rxbinding:0.2.0' + implementation 'com.jakewharton.rxbinding:rxbinding:0.2.0' - compile project(':media-picker') + implementation project(':media-picker') } diff --git a/media-picker/build.gradle b/media-picker/build.gradle index 61d9dad..08bc53f 100644 --- a/media-picker/build.gradle +++ b/media-picker/build.gradle @@ -23,19 +23,19 @@ android { dependencies { //noinspection GradleDynamicVersion - provided 'com.android.support:appcompat-v7:27+' + implementation 'com.android.support:appcompat-v7:27+' //noinspection GradleDynamicVersion - provided 'com.android.support:animated-vector-drawable:27+' + implementation 'com.android.support:animated-vector-drawable:27+' //noinspection GradleDynamicVersion - provided 'com.android.support:support-compat:27+' + implementation 'com.android.support:support-compat:27+' //noinspection GradleDynamicVersion - provided 'com.android.support:support-core-utils:27+' + implementation 'com.android.support:support-core-utils:27+' // File cropping utility. - compile 'com.github.yalantis:ucrop:2.2.2' + api 'com.github.yalantis:ucrop:2.2.2' } apply from: '../build.release-aar.gradle'